onokazu
onoka****@users*****
2006年 4月 8日 (土) 14:10:38 JST
Index: xoops2jp/html/kernel/member.php diff -u xoops2jp/html/kernel/member.php:1.4.6.1 xoops2jp/html/kernel/member.php:1.4.6.2 --- xoops2jp/html/kernel/member.php:1.4.6.1 Sun Feb 5 14:19:52 2006 +++ xoops2jp/html/kernel/member.php Sat Apr 8 14:10:37 2006 @@ -1,5 +1,5 @@ <?php -// $Id: member.php,v 1.4.6.1 2006/02/05 05:19:52 onokazu Exp $ +// $Id: member.php,v 1.4.6.2 2006/04/08 05:10:37 onokazu Exp $ // ------------------------------------------------------------------------ // // XOOPS - PHP Content Management System // // Copyright (c) 2000 XOOPS.org // @@ -322,26 +322,20 @@ * * @param string $uname username as entered in the login form * @param string $pwd password entered in the login form - * @return object XoopsUser reference to the logged in user. FALSE if failed to log in + * @return mixed XoopsUser reference to the logged in user. FALSE if failed to log in */ function &loginUser($uname, $pwd) { - $criteria = new CriteriaCompo(new Criteria('uname', $uname)); - $criteria->add(new Criteria('pass', md5($pwd))); - $user =& $this->_uHandler->getObjects($criteria, false); - if (!$user || count($user) != 1) { - $ret = false; - return $ret; - } - return $user[0]; + $user =& $this->loginUserMd5($uname, md5($pwd)); + return $user; } /** - * logs in a user with an nd5 encrypted password + * logs in a user with an md5 encrypted password * * @param string $uname username * @param string $md5pwd password encrypted with md5 - * @return object XoopsUser reference to the logged in user. FALSE if failed to log in + * @return mixed XoopsUser reference to the logged in user. FALSE if failed to log in */ function &loginUserMd5($uname, $md5pwd) {